Post-Democracism and Resistance

Ghandi was right when he joked that Western democracy was a great idea, someone should give it a go. Even in ancient Greece, the ‘cradle of democracy’, large portions of the population were excluded from participation. Not only were women and slaves denied even their most basic human rights, but even many 'free' men could not afford to take office, because in those days politicians didn’t get paid a salary by the state.

In modern times the situation only got worse. To make any significant difference, leave alone gain office, politicians need to form or join a party. For such party to be successful, it needs to spend lots of money on party organization and election campaigns. It also needs lots of publicity and that comes at a price too. You only need to watch how desperately U.S. presidential candidates are trying to earn brownie points with the likes of Rupert Murdoch. Whoever brings in the most donations and media support has the most power within a party organization. This is how parties get corrupted by lobby interests, in America and everywhere.
